I just downloaded the app, and see that RCSS here in Kitchener is now participating. There are maybe 12-15 offerings, mostly meat; however, I'm not seeing the kind of discounts mentioned earlier in this thread. Everything shows up as 50% off with pretty much all the Best Before dates being the next day.
The problem is that overpriced Strip Loin steaks, at say, reg. $16lb would work out to $8 lb at 50% discount.
Why would I buy this, when RCSS regularly has super specials like $4.77lb (recent) - $5.xx lb on fresh AAA strip loins.
